Robertson Selected to Lead Indiana Insurance Department
Indiana Gov. Mitch Daniels has appointed Stephen Robertson as commissioner of the Department of Insurance (DOI). Robertson, who has served as DOI’s executive director since June, replaces Carol Cutter who passed away last month.
Robertson joined DOI in 2008, first as director of the Title Insurance Division and then deputy commissioner of the Title and Bail Bond Division. He ensured the legal compliance of 41 insurance companies and 800 insurance agencies, as well as regulatory oversight of 375 bail bond and recovery agents. He has a long career of both public and private service, including nearly a decade with the Conseco Insurance Group in Carmel, where he was senior vice president. Robertson has also served as general counsel of the Nebraska Department of Insurance and was a sergeant in the military police. He is a member of the Indiana and Nebraska State Bar Associations and the American Bar Association.
